Course Details
• Language Access Foundations: Understanding the importance of language access, legal requirements, and cultural competency in NGOs.
• Assessing Language Needs: Identifying the language needs of limited English proficient (LEP) individuals and communities.
• Language Proficiency Assessments: Evaluating the language proficiency of bilingual staff and interpreters.
• Interpretation Services: Best practices for consecutive and simultaneous interpretation, sight translation, and remote interpretation.
• Translation Services: Effective strategies for document translation, maintaining accuracy and confidentiality, and working with translation vendors.
• Bilingual Staff Management: Policies and training for managing bilingual staff, avoiding language barriers, and ensuring effective communication.
• Language Access Technology: Overview of language access technology, such as remote interpretation platforms, speech recognition software, and translation management systems.
• Quality Assurance and Monitoring: Techniques for monitoring and improving the quality of language access services.
• Creating a Language Access Plan: Developing a comprehensive language access plan for NGOs, including policies, procedures, and training programs.
